杉木自毒作用的研究

摘要: 对杉木自毒作用研究表明,杉木纯林中的土壤、枯落叶、半分解枯落叶和杉木鲜叶、枝条、树皮、树根的水浸液及其添加乙烯吡咯啉酮k30(PVP)的溶液对杉木种子、空心菜种子和萝卜种子的萌发均有影响。所有水浸液均表现出高浓度下抑制种子萌发,随着浓度降低,抑制作用减弱、消失,甚至转变为促进作用的规律;其中根和鲜叶水浸液抑制作用最强,但水浸液添加PVP后抑制作用明显减弱,且在低浓度时表现出促进作用。

Abstract: Studies on the autointoxication of Chinese fir show that the aqueous extracts of surface soil, leaf litter, half decaying leaf litter, fresh leaf, branch, bark and root in pure Chinese fir plantation and their polyvinyl pyrrolidone k30 (PVP) solutions affected the seed germination of Chinese fir, Raphanus sativous and water convolvulus. At high concentration of aqueous extracts, seed germination was significantly inhibited, while with decreasing concentration, the inhibitory effects got weaker, disappeared and even turned into stimulating effects. The aqueous extracts added PVPsignificantly weakened the inhibitory effect, and exhibited enhancement effect at low concentration.
